Fluffernutter Cookies Recipe
These Fluffernutter Cookies are a delightful twist on the classic sandwich, combining the flavors of peanut butter and marshmallows in a chewy cookie form. Perfect for any occasion, these cookies are sure to be a hit with kids and adults alike.

Dry Ingredients:
- 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our (stirred, spooned & leveled)
- 1 tsp baking soda
- ½ tsp salt
Wet Ingredients:
- 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½ cup light brown sugar, packed
- ½ cup creamy peanut butter
- 1 large egg
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
Additions:
- 1 cup mini marshmallows, frozen*
- Prepare Marshmallows: Freeze marshmallows for 1-2 hours before using; keep in freezer until ready to bake.
- Preheat Oven: Preheat to 350°F and line baking sheets.
- Mix Dry Ingredients: Combine flour, baking soda, and salt in a bowl.
- Cream Butter and Sugars: Beat butter and sugars until light and creamy.
- Add Wet Ingredients: Mix in peanut butter, egg, and vanilla. Incorporate dry ingredients.
- Integrate Marshmallows: Fold in a heaping cup of frozen marshmallows.
- Shape Dough: Use a scoop to form dough balls and place on baking sheet.
- Bake: Bake at 350°F for 11-12 minutes until edges brown. Cool on tray before transferring.
Notes
- *Tip: Freezing marshmallows prevents excessive melting during baking.
- Store cookies in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
